Meter - Spondee

The spondee consists of two stressed syllables. It is unique in the English language as it is the only metrical foot that does not contain an unstressed syllable.


Because of this nature of the spondee, a serious poem cannot be solely spondaic. It would be almost impossible to construsct a poem entirely of stressed syllables. Therefore the spondee usually occurs alone within - say an apaestic poem.
